Minister for Education, Science and Technology Bidhya Bhattarai has resigned from her post amid ongoing protests by teachers demanding reforms in the education sector.

She submitted her resignation to Prime Minister KP Sharma Oli on Monday afternoon, following weeks of pressure from teachers who have been staging demonstrations in Kathmandu for over 20 days.

The protesting teachers are calling for the government to pass the new School Education Act by addressing their demands. Although Minister Bhattarai had held multiple discussions with key leaders and officials, including the Prime Minister, Finance Minister and the Speaker, the talks failed to produce results.

According to Bhattarai’s press coordinator, Ramji Lamsal, her resignation was officially handed over today (April 21) after a meeting with Prime Minister Oli. The Ministry has confirmed her resignation.

Teachers' representatives say the movement will continue until their demands are addressed through law, stating that previous promises must now be honored with concrete action.
